(AB) 'Dead Sea Scrolls'

1960, Zurbrigg

'Dead Sea Scrolls' OB- (Lloyd Zurbrigg, R. 1960). Sdlg. 54-82. AB, 16” (41 cm). Early bloom. Standards lavender to light violet; Falls red violet; bronze beard; diffused signal. Edmison blue dwarf X 'Capitola'. Avonbank, 1961.
